What if this, what if that...we all do it, every second, every day. Otherwise we wouldn't be human. This book was not designed to make you like or not like certain topics spoken on or touched upon. It is to invite you into the "universal minds" that we all live in. When I say universal minds, I mean...things that we all think about, but not necessarily act upon or even mention to others. As I began to write this book I knew that I wanted my readers to feel like there in that particular situation. Whether the poem be a family poem, Godly poem, sexual poem, love poem, etc...if the words don't run through your body as you read, than I didn't do a good job writing and expressing these thoughts.



We as human beings have fantasies that we enjoy embracing within our own minds. I thought to myself, if we all have these images that seem so far from reality, why not bring the thoughts of all to paper through my words to create these images for others as well.



My very close friends inspired me, as well as family, people I never even knew, or knew for just a second of my life. I want you to become intoxicated and obligated to setting your mind free.

Born August 08, 1978, Brooklyn, New York in Kings County Hospital weighing in at 10lbs8oz. Yeah! Big boy, the biggest one and biggest boy my mom gave birth to. Resided in Brooklyn, NY up until the age of 5 and then moved to Rosedale, NY. Attended St. Clare's Elementary, then attended an English/French grammar school in Haiti for a year as I overextended my vacation with my siblings. I would return to NYC to continue my education at St. Pius X School in Rosedale. I have great memories growing up in Rosedale and going to school there. Till this day some of my closest friends are from my childhood. I feel and know that I am fortunate to have such great friends around me. Holy Cross High School is where I would do my four years of not having classes with girls, lol. It was cool thought, lots of laughs, and I knew I was there for two things, books and football. It didn't matter, the girls liked themselves some Holy Cross Knights, they would come up to our school for basketball games, football games, or just to hang outside to see who they could try to approach at the upcoming school dances. Yall remember school dances, Salt 'n' Peppa, Big Daddy Kane, etc...dancing music, not head nodding music. After words, Morgan State University is where decided to continue my education and football career. Although I made great friends there and still keep in touch with them, I would transfer to L.I.U.-C.W. Post Campus in New York. I would receive my Bachelor's in Psychology. Now, presently in Grad School studying to obtain my MBA/HR Mgmt. Enjoy the book.
